A fault tolerant object management framework based on middleware for dynamic reconfiguration

英文摘要An important emerging requirement for distributed systems is adaptive QoS, which necessitates more flexible system infrastructure components that can adapt robustly to dynamic end-to-end changes in application requirements and environmental conditions. This paper shows how to add a characteristic of dynamic configuration, from the perspective of fault tolerance QoS, to the fault tolerant object management framework based on middleware. Three specific technical challenges in satisfying the requirements are: 1) perceive the changes of environment; 2) define the trigger for reconfiguration; 3) reconfigure the resources if the trigger satisfied. We define dynamic reconfiguration as the relation among fault tolerance properties, description of computing environment changes and dynamic adjustment algorithm, Based on this definition the management framework for dynamic reconfiguration is built. In which, the introduction of reflection model and publish/subscribe model makes the acquirement and notification of information more convenient and flexible, and the adoption of policy customization mechanism makes reconfiguration enforced more effectively. The framework presented in this paper has been validated in a prototype. ? 2005 World Scientific Publishing Co. Pte. Ltd.; EI; 0
